智能问答助手的问答准确率提升技巧

随着人工智能技术的飞速发展,智能问答助手在各个领域的应用越来越广泛。然而,在实际应用中,智能问答助手的问答准确率往往难以达到用户期望。本文将通过讲述一位智能问答助手研发者的故事,分享一些提升问答准确率的技巧。

这位研发者名叫小张,他毕业后进入了一家专注于智能问答助手研发的公司。起初,他对智能问答助手充满了信心,认为凭借自己的技术,一定能够研发出让用户满意的问答助手。然而,在实际研发过程中,他却遇到了许多困难。

有一天,小张接到了一个来自用户的反馈,用户抱怨智能问答助手的回答总是不准确。这让小张十分困惑,他开始分析问题所在。经过一番研究,他发现以下几个问题导致了问答准确率的下降:

  1. 语义理解能力不足:由于自然语言具有复杂性和多义性,智能问答助手在处理一些含糊不清或者歧义较大的问题时,往往难以准确理解用户意图。

  2. 知识库质量不高:智能问答助手依赖知识库来回答问题,而知识库的质量直接影响着问答的准确性。如果知识库中存在错误信息或者缺失信息,智能问答助手就难以给出正确的答案。

  3. 问答系统训练不足:问答系统的训练过程至关重要,只有经过大量数据的训练,才能提高问答系统的准确率。然而,在实际研发过程中,小张发现很多研发者并没有重视问答系统的训练。

针对以上问题,小张开始着手解决。以下是他在提升问答准确率方面的一些经验和技巧:

一、提高语义理解能力

  1. 引入语义分析技术:通过引入自然语言处理(NLP)技术,如词性标注、句法分析、语义角色标注等,对用户输入的问题进行深入分析,提高对用户意图的准确理解。

  2. 优化分词算法:分词是语义理解的基础,优化分词算法可以降低歧义现象,提高问答系统的准确率。

  3. 利用上下文信息:在处理含糊不清或者歧义较大的问题时,结合上下文信息进行判断,提高对用户意图的准确理解。

二、提高知识库质量

  1. 知识抽取:从互联网或其他领域获取高质量的知识,进行知识抽取,构建一个丰富的知识库。

  2. 知识融合:将不同来源的知识进行整合,消除知识库中的冲突和冗余。

  3. 知识更新:定期对知识库进行更新,确保知识库中的信息始终准确、可靠。

三、加强问答系统训练

  1. 增加训练数据:收集更多高质量的数据,提高问答系统的泛化能力。

  2. 调整模型参数:通过不断调整模型参数,优化问答系统的性能。

  3. 模型优化:尝试不同的模型结构,寻找更适合问答系统的模型。

经过一段时间的努力,小张研发的智能问答助手问答准确率得到了显著提高。他的成功经验也得到了同事们的认可。以下是他总结的提升问答准确率的几点建议:

  1. 关注用户反馈:及时收集用户反馈,了解用户需求,针对性地解决问题。

  2. 不断优化技术:紧跟技术发展趋势,不断优化问答系统,提高准确率。

  3. 注重团队协作:加强与团队成员的沟通与合作,共同提升问答系统的性能。

总之,提升智能问答助手的问答准确率需要从多个方面入手。通过不断优化技术、加强团队协作,我们相信智能问答助手将会在未来的发展中发挥更大的作用。

猜你喜欢:deepseek聊天